Role Overview
The Insurance Verification Coordinator is responsible for obtaining insurance benefits, verifying eligibility, securing prior authorizations, and ensuring accurate documentation to support timely patient care and reimbursement.
Key Responsibilities
- Verify insurance eligibility, benefits, coverage, and financial responsibility for patients.
- Obtain and manage prior authorizations and pre-certifications for inpatient and outpatient services.
- Collaborate with providers, payers, scheduling teams, and revenue cycle departments to prevent authorization delays and denials.
